01.07.2013 Views

Xilinx Constraints Guide

Xilinx Constraints Guide

Xilinx Constraints Guide

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Chapter 4: <strong>Xilinx</strong> <strong>Constraints</strong><br />

Do not use the reserved words in the table below as identifier.<br />

Reserved Words (<strong>Constraints</strong>)<br />

ADD ALU ASSIGN<br />

BEL BLKNM CAP<br />

CLKDV_DIVIDE CLBNM CMOS<br />

CYMODE DECODE DEF<br />

DIVIDE1_BY DIVIDE2_BY DOUBLE<br />

DRIVE DUTY_CYCLE_CORRECTION FAST<br />

FBKINV FILE F_SET<br />

HBLKNM HU_SET H_SET<br />

INIT INIT OX INTERNAL<br />

IOB IOSTANDARD LIBVER<br />

LOC LOWPWR MAP<br />

MEDFAST MEDSLOW MINIM<br />

NODELAY OPT OSC<br />

RES RLOC RLOC_ORIGIN<br />

RLOC_RANGE SCHNM SLOW<br />

STARTUP_WAIT SYSTEM TNM<br />

TRIM TS TTL<br />

TYPE USE_RLOC U_SET<br />

You can specify as many groups of end points as are necessary to describe the<br />

performance requirements of your design. However, to simplify the specification<br />

process and reduce the Place and Route (PAR) time, use as few groups as possible.<br />

XCF Syntax<br />

See UCF and NCF Syntax below.<br />

<strong>Constraints</strong> Editor Syntax<br />

For information on setting constraints in <strong>Constraints</strong> Editor, including syntax, see the<br />

<strong>Constraints</strong> Editor Help.<br />

PlanAhead Syntax<br />

For more information about using the PlanAhead software to create constraints, see<br />

Floorplanning the Design in the PlanAhead User <strong>Guide</strong> (UG632). See PlanAhead in this<br />

<strong>Guide</strong> for information about:<br />

• Defining placement constraints<br />

• Assigning placement constraints<br />

• Defining I/O pin configurations<br />

• Floorplanning and placement constraints<br />

<strong>Constraints</strong> <strong>Guide</strong><br />

292 www.xilinx.com UG625 (v. 13.2) July 6, 2011

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!